Many people are not aware that their conviction in Big Stone Gap, Virginia can be expunged? Expungement is a legal process that removes a criminal conviction from your record. This allows you to legally tell most employers inquiring into your background that you have not been convicted of a crime.

Record Expungement in Big Stone Gap

Expunging your criminal history normally involves you collecting all original case documents and then filing your application with the appropriate court in Big Stone Gap, Virginia

Not all states allow expungement, and in particular cases the record may be sealed without action on your part. Expungement can be a complicated and time consuming process depending on when and where your conviction took place.
